HOLIDAY LIGHTED CARRIAGE PARADE ILLUMINATES THE HOLIDAY SEASON AT MARKET STREET SATURDAY, DECEMBER 2

Don't miss Market Street's signature holiday event, the 3 rd annual Lighted Horse and Carriage Parade, certain to delight all ages Saturday, December 2 at 7pm.

The Lighted Horse & Carriage Parade will feature brilliantly illuminated and ornate, horse-drawn carriages from the Houston Area Carriage Association and Houston-area carriage owners. Grab a curbside seat and don't forget your camera as these magical carriages, straight out of storybooks, pass by.

Huge Clydesdales, petite miniature horses, and maybe even a donkey or two will entertain crowds with their colorful holiday carriages as they spread holiday cheer at Market Street. The parade is set to begin at 7 pm.

Holiday performances in Central Park will delight visitors beginning at 6 pm, and the carriages will be on display beginning at 4 pm.

All Market Street holiday events are free and open to the public.

Located across the street from The Cynthia Woods Mitchell Pavilion, Market Street is bounded by Lake Woodlands Drive, Lake Robbins Drive, Grogan's Mill Road and Six Pines Drive.

Market Street is a joint-venture development of Trademark Property Company and Kimco Developers, Inc., an affiliate of the real estate investment trust (REIT) Kimco Realty Corporation.
